A key step in managing basement leaks is proper inspection. Carefully examine the perimeter for gaps, and pinpoint any areas where water may be entering. Once you have a clear picture of the problem, you can apply suitable waterproofing measures.
Many effective waterproofing solutions are available, each with its own strengths. These include:
* **Exterior Waterproofing:** This method involves applying a waterproof barrier to the outside of your structure, effectively blocking water from reaching contact with the interior.
* **Interior Waterproofing:** For existing leaks, interior waterproofing methods concentrate on creating a waterproof layer within your basement. This can be accomplished through the installation of coatings, membranes, or damp-proof materials.
* **Drainage Systems:** Installing a proper drainage system around your property is crucial for redirecting water away from your basement. This can involve trenching and setting up drain tiles, weeping systems, or sumps pumps.
By meticulously evaluating your situation and selecting the most appropriate waterproofing solutions, you can effectively stop basement leaks and create a safe, dry, and healthy environment within your home.

Water damage within your basement can be a costly and troublesome problem. But the good news is that many water damage issues can prevented by properly protecting your basement. A well-sealed basement acts as a barrier against moisture, keeping your home dry and sound.
Prior to|you start any work on your basement, it's important to identify the source of the potential water problem. Typical culprits include: cracks in foundation walls, gaps around windows and doors, and inadequate drainage near your home. Once you've identified the source, you can take steps to address it.
Here are some essential tips for sealing your basement:
- Verify that the ground around your foundation slopes away from the house.
- Install a drainage system to divert water from your foundation.
- Seal any cracks or gaps in your foundation walls and floors.
- Mend damaged gutters and downspouts.
By taking these precautions, you can effectively prevent water damage and keep your basement dry.
